i
Rakuten
Filter interviews by
I applied via Approached by company and was interviewed in Dec 2021. There were 3 interview rounds.
Basic Reasoning and DS, Algo Question and 4 Coding in java and 3 Sql commands question on grouping
JVM is a virtual machine that executes Java bytecode. Objects are created and managed in JVM memory using heap and stack.
JVM stands for Java Virtual Machine
It is responsible for executing Java bytecode
Objects are created in JVM memory using heap and stack
Heap is used for storing objects and stack is used for storing method calls
Garbage collector is responsible for managing memory in JVM
Polymorphism is the ability of an object to take on many forms. Overriding is when a subclass provides a specific implementation of a method that is already provided by its parent class.
Polymorphism allows objects to be treated as if they are of any of their compatible types.
Overriding is used to provide a specific implementation of a method that is already provided by its parent class.
Example: Animal class has a metho...
A stack is a data structure that follows the Last-In-First-Out (LIFO) principle.
Stack is a linear data structure
Elements are added and removed from the same end called the top
Common operations include push (add element) and pop (remove element)
Stack can be implemented using arrays or linked lists
I applied via Naukri.com
Hacker earth - arrays, string and trees concept question
I was interviewed in Apr 2024.
Array string easy medium questions
20 questions were there to solve
Rakuten interview questions for designations
I applied via LinkedIn and was interviewed before Sep 2023. There were 2 interview rounds.
Had a live coding test with the interviewer with medium level questions and the interviewer was helpful
System design for Uber involves creating a scalable and efficient platform for matching riders with drivers.
Use microservices architecture for scalability and flexibility
Implement geolocation services for real-time tracking
Utilize algorithms for efficient matching of riders and drivers
Include payment processing system for seamless transactions
Create Hashmap, Tell about hashet and some basic questions
I applied via Naukri.com and was interviewed before Apr 2023. There were 2 interview rounds.
Java and DSA. DSA contains of 2 medium level question
I applied via Walk-in and was interviewed before Apr 2023. There were 2 interview rounds.
Asked about Java basics questions and SQL queries
Top trending discussions
I applied via Campus Placement and was interviewed in Nov 2024. There were 3 interview rounds.
JUST BASIC CODING WITH MCQ AND MEETLE PLATFORM
2 Interview rounds
based on 18 reviews
Rating in categories
Senior Software Engineer
220
salaries
| ₹9.9 L/yr - ₹33 L/yr |
Software Engineer
217
salaries
| ₹4 L/yr - ₹16.8 L/yr |
Technical Lead
187
salaries
| ₹15 L/yr - ₹44.7 L/yr |
Devops Engineer
133
salaries
| ₹5.6 L/yr - ₹15 L/yr |
Senior Software Engineer 2
131
salaries
| ₹16.7 L/yr - ₹40 L/yr |
Amazon
eBay
Netflix
Flipkart